View on leginfo.ca.govPsychosurgery, wherever administered, may be performed only if:
(a)The patient gives written informed consent to the psychosurgery.
(b)A responsible relative of the person’s choosing and with the person’s consent, and the guardian or conservator if there is one, has read the standard consent form as defined in Section 5326.4 and has been given by the treating physician the information required in Section 5326.2. Should the person desire not to inform a relative or should such chosen relative be unavailable this requirement is dispensed with.
